What Are Explosion-Proof Rubber Tires?
Explosion-proof rubber tires are industrial tires made from high-strength, resilient rubber compounds that are designed to resist punctures, extreme loads, and thermal stress. Unlike standard tires, these tires incorporate advanced structural designs and materials that prevent sudden blowouts, even under hazardous operating conditions.
Key features include:
● Puncture resistance – Reinforced rubber layers prevent accidental punctures from sharp objects.
● Heat resistance – Capable of handling high temperatures without compromising integrity.
● Load capacity – Engineered to carry heavy industrial equipment safely.
● Durability – Withstand repetitive stress and harsh operational conditions.
Explosion-proof rubber tires are widely used in environments where tire failure could lead to safety incidents, costly repairs, or operational downtime.

Materials and Technology
The technology behind explosion-proof rubber tires focuses on combining strength, resilience, and safety:
● Reinforced Rubber Compounds – High-tensile materials resist cuts, punctures, and thermal stress.
● Layered Construction – Multi-layered designs distribute load evenly and enhance durability.
● Heat-Resistant Additives – Special compounds allow tires to withstand high-temperature operations.
● Shock Absorption Design – Minimizes vibrations transmitted to the vehicle and operator, reducing wear and fatigue.
These innovations ensure that explosion-proof tires perform reliably in the harshest industrial conditions.
Selecting the Right Explosion-Proof Rubber Tire
When selecting explosion-proof rubber tires, B2B operators should consider:
● Load Capacity – Match the tire to the maximum weight of the equipment and operational load.
● Surface Compatibility – Consider the flooring or terrain type to ensure optimal grip and safety.
● Environmental Conditions – Evaluate exposure to heat, chemicals, or sharp debris.
● Durability Requirements – High-traffic or heavy-duty environments may need reinforced designs.
● Supplier Support – Choose suppliers offering warranty, technical support, and after-sales service.
Careful selection ensures maximum performance, operational safety, and return on investment.
